Will a Memory Foam Mattress Soften Over Time?

Memory foam mattresses are renowned for their shape-shifting abilities, moulding to the contours of your body to provide support, comfort and a great night’s sleep like no other mattress can.

You’ve placed your order and eagerly awaited its arrival, only for the mattress to arrive... but you're instantly not a fan. It’s far too firm. However, you need to approach foam mattresses with patience and allow them to adapt to you.

So, let’s answer the question you’re wondering about – will a memory foam mattresses soften over time?

Yes. Memory foam mattresses do soften over time. The heat and weight of your body will cause the mattress to become softer with just a few weeks of use.

 

How Long Does It Take to Break In Memory Foam?

 

Don’t panic if your memory foam mattress feels firmer than you’d hoped. It won’t stay that way forever.

These types of mattresses are designed to mould to their owner, so they take a little time and patience for the dense memory foam to decompress and adjust to your unique body shape. Think of this stage as a marathon, not a sprint, and you’ll be enjoying the best night’s sleep of your life before you know it.

Generally speaking, the breaking-in period, after which your new bed will feel softer, can be anywhere between two and four weeks. Luckily, we have a few tricks up our sleeve that might help you speed the process up a bit…

 

How Do You Make A Memory Foam Mattress Softer?

Turn up the heat!

One thing to note about memory foam is that it’s temperature-sensitive. The temperature-sensitive qualities are the reason the foam is able to mould and adapt to the curves of your body in the first place, so you can use this to your advantage on your journey to a medium-soft or soft mattress.

If you can, raise the temperature in your bedroom, especially while you’re lying on the memory foam mattress. This will encourage the foam to soften and mould to your body much more easily. A cold room can make a foam mattress firmer, so crank up the heating a few notches when you first buy your mattress. Then you can allow your body heat – and the radiators – to work their magic and make your firm foam bed softer. You can also heat the mattress with an electric blanket or hot water bottles.

Step To It!

Have you always been told to stop jumping on the bed? Us too, but we’re going to tell you to temporarily overlook this rule - kind of. 

Rather than an intrusive jump, gently walking or even crawling on the top of the mattress can help to relax the foam and make for a much softer sleeping environment, and it is probably one of the most effective ways of doing so. 

Before walking, it’s best to take it off the frame to avoid causing damage to the bed frame or its slats. If the mattress is too heavy to do this a couple of times a day, it’s best to stick to the kneading your knees method - unless you’re confident in the foundations of your bed. 

Try Out a Memory Foam Topper

Buying a mattress topper is a quick way to achieve your desired firmness in the adjustment period of your new mattress. 

Memory foam mattress toppers offer a layer of supportive comfort to your existing mattress, and because of the slight difference in structure and density than a proper mattress, they’re far more forgiving and shouldn’t need their own breaking in period.
